技术领域Technical Field
本实用新型涉及红茶发酵技术领域,具体为一种红茶发酵机用自动翻料装置。The utility model relates to the technical field of black tea fermentation, in particular to an automatic material turning device for a black tea fermentation machine.
背景技术Background Art
红茶属于全发酵茶,是以适宜的茶树新芽叶为原料,揉捻、发酵和干燥等一系列工艺过程精制而成的茶。红茶具有红茶、红汤、红叶和香甜味醇的特征,我国红茶品种以祁门红茶最为著名。Black tea is a fully fermented tea, made from new buds and leaves of suitable tea trees, through a series of processes such as rolling, fermentation and drying. Black tea has the characteristics of black tea, red soup, red leaves and sweet and mellow taste. Keemun black tea is the most famous black tea variety in my country.
发酵是形成红茶香味的关键因素,在红茶发酵过程中翻料可以使茶叶整体发酵均匀一致,经检索,公开号CN219660850U一种便于翻料的红茶发酵装置,通过轴杆带动第一齿轮转动,且第一齿轮与齿轮环相啮合,从而带动齿轮环与发酵筒转动,并通过辅助轮辅助,进而对发酵筒3内部的红茶进行翻料,使得红茶能够均匀发酵,通过雾化喷头喷出,同时通过电热板对电热丝进行加热,使得水雾因温度提高变为水蒸气,此时通过风扇将水蒸气输送至发酵筒中红茶一侧从而提高红茶的发酵效率。发酵需要一定湿度和温度,仅通过发热丝对发酵筒加热,然后再传递给茶叶效率较低且不均匀。Fermentation is a key factor in forming the aroma of black tea. During the fermentation process of black tea, turning the material can make the overall fermentation of the tea leaves uniform and consistent. After searching, the publication number CN219660850U is a black tea fermentation device that is easy to turn the material. The first gear is driven to rotate by the shaft, and the first gear is meshed with the gear ring, thereby driving the gear ring and the fermentation cylinder to rotate, and the auxiliary wheel is used to assist, and then the black tea inside the fermentation cylinder 3 is turned over, so that the black tea can be fermented evenly, and sprayed out through the atomizing nozzle, and the electric heating wire is heated by the electric heating plate at the same time, so that the water mist is turned into water vapor due to the increase in temperature. At this time, the water vapor is transported to the black tea side of the fermentation cylinder by the fan, thereby improving the fermentation efficiency of the black tea. Fermentation requires a certain humidity and temperature. It is inefficient and uneven to heat the fermentation cylinder only by the heating wire and then transfer it to the tea leaves.

如图1~3所示,本实用新型采取的技术方案如下:一种红茶发酵机用自动翻料装置,包括支撑底座1、支撑架2、发酵罐3、驱动结构4、翻料结构5和喷淋发酵结构6,支撑架2设于支撑底座1上,发酵罐3两端转动设于支撑架2内相对侧壁,发酵罐3上设有进出料口7,驱动结构4设于支撑架2内顶壁,翻料结构5设于发酵罐3内,喷淋发酵结构6安装在支撑底座1上且位于支撑架2两侧,发酵罐3为夹层罐,夹层罐内部设有加热块,支撑底座1中部滑动设有收纳腔28,收纳腔28侧壁设有推拉把手29,支撑底座1底部设有四组支撑垫脚30,四组支撑垫脚30均布设于支撑垫脚30底部四角处。As shown in Figures 1 to 3, the technical solution adopted by the utility model is as follows: an automatic turning device for a black tea fermentation machine, comprising a support base 1, a support frame 2, a fermentation tank 3, a driving structure 4, a turning structure 5 and a spray fermentation structure 6. The support frame 2 is arranged on the support base 1, and the two ends of the fermentation tank 3 are rotatably arranged on opposite side walls inside the support frame 2. The fermentation tank 3 is provided with an inlet and outlet 7, the driving structure 4 is arranged on the top wall inside the support frame 2, the turning structure 5 is arranged in the fermentation tank 3, and the spray fermentation structure 6 is installed on the support base 1 and is located on both sides of the support frame 2. The fermentation tank 3 is a sandwich tank, and a heating block is arranged inside the sandwich tank. A storage cavity 28 is slidably provided in the middle part of the support base 1, and a push-pull handle 29 is provided on the side wall of the storage cavity 28. Four groups of support feet 30 are provided at the bottom of the support base 1, and the four groups of support feet 30 are arranged at the four corners of the bottom of the support feet 30.
如图2所示,驱动结构4包括驱动仓8、双轴电机9、齿轮10和齿环11,驱动仓8设于支撑架2内顶壁,双轴电机9设于驱动仓8内底壁,齿轮10设有两组且安装在双轴电机9的动力输出轴上,齿环11设有两组且套设于发酵罐3外壁,齿轮10和齿环11啮合。As shown in Figure 2, the driving structure 4 includes a driving bin 8, a dual-axis motor 9, a gear 10 and a gear ring 11. The driving bin 8 is arranged on the inner top wall of the support frame 2, the dual-axis motor 9 is arranged on the inner bottom wall of the driving bin 8, the gear 10 is provided in two groups and is installed on the power output shaft of the dual-axis motor 9, the gear ring 11 is provided in two groups and is sleeved on the outer wall of the fermentation tank 3, and the gear 10 and the gear ring 11 are meshed.
如图2和图3所示,翻料结构5包括电机防护壳12、驱动电机13、锥齿轮14、搅拌轴15和搅拌架16,电机防护壳12设于支撑架2的侧壁,驱动电机13设于电机防护壳12内底壁,搅拌轴15一端转动设于电机防护壳12内侧壁,搅拌轴15另一端依次贯穿支撑架2和发酵罐3且转动设于支撑架2的另一侧壁,锥齿轮14设有两组,一组锥齿轮14设于驱动电机13的动力输出轴上,另一组锥齿轮14设于搅拌轴15上,两组锥齿轮14啮合,搅拌架16为C型结构设置,搅拌架16设于搅拌轴15上,搅拌架16上设有刮板17和搅拌杆18,刮板17与发酵罐3内壁相接触。As shown in Figures 2 and 3, the material turning structure 5 includes a motor protective shell 12, a drive motor 13, a bevel gear 14, a stirring shaft 15 and a stirring frame 16. The motor protective shell 12 is arranged on the side wall of the support frame 2, and the drive motor 13 is arranged on the inner bottom wall of the motor protective shell 12. One end of the stirring shaft 15 is rotatably arranged on the inner side wall of the motor protective shell 12, and the other end of the stirring shaft 15 sequentially penetrates the support frame 2 and the fermentation tank 3 and is rotatably arranged on the other side wall of the support frame 2. There are two groups of bevel gears 14, one group of bevel gears 14 is arranged on the power output shaft of the drive motor 13, and the other group of bevel gears 14 is arranged on the stirring shaft 15. The two groups of bevel gears 14 are meshed, and the stirring frame 16 is arranged in a C-shaped structure. The stirring frame 16 is arranged on the stirring shaft 15. A scraper 17 and a stirring rod 18 are provided on the stirring frame 16, and the scraper 17 contacts the inner wall of the fermentation tank 3.
如图2和图3所示,喷淋发酵结构6包括水箱19、水管20、水泵21和热风机22,水箱19设于支撑底座1上,水泵21设于水箱19顶部,搅拌轴15内设有喷淋管路23和热风管路24,搅拌轴15上设有喷淋头25和热风口26,喷淋头25与喷淋管路23相连通,热风口26与热风管路24相连通,水管20一端位于水箱19内部,水管20另一端通过旋转接头与喷淋管路23相连通,水管20与水泵21相连接,热风机22设于支撑底座1上且位于支撑架2另一侧,热风机22上的热风管通过旋转结构与热风管路24相连通。As shown in Figures 2 and 3, the spray fermentation structure 6 includes a water tank 19, a water pipe 20, a water pump 21 and a hot air blower 22. The water tank 19 is arranged on the support base 1, and the water pump 21 is arranged on the top of the water tank 19. A spray pipeline 23 and a hot air pipeline 24 are arranged in the stirring shaft 15. A spray head 25 and a hot air outlet 26 are arranged on the stirring shaft 15. The spray head 25 is connected to the spray pipeline 23, and the hot air outlet 26 is connected to the hot air pipeline 24. One end of the water pipe 20 is located inside the water tank 19, and the other end of the water pipe 20 is connected to the spray pipeline 23 through a rotating joint. The water pipe 20 is connected to the water pump 21. The hot air blower 22 is arranged on the support base 1 and on the other side of the support frame 2. The hot air pipe on the hot air blower 22 is connected to the hot air pipeline 24 through a rotating structure.
其中,支撑架2侧壁设有控制显示屏27,双轴电机9、驱动电机13、水泵21、加热块和热风机22均与控制显示屏27电性连接。A control display screen 27 is disposed on the side wall of the support frame 2 , and the dual-axis motor 9 , the drive motor 13 , the water pump 21 , the heating block and the hot air blower 22 are all electrically connected to the control display screen 27 .
具体使用时,通过进出料口7向发酵罐3内部投入红茶叶,通过双轴电机9驱动齿轮10转动,进而驱动齿环11转动,使发酵罐3旋转,启动驱动电机13,通过锥齿轮14驱动搅拌轴15转动,进而带动刮板17和搅拌杆18转动,对茶叶翻料,通过水泵21将喷淋水通过喷淋管路23和喷淋头25对茶叶喷淋,通过设置的加热块、热风机22、热风管路24和热风口26对内部茶叶均匀加热,完成发酵后将进出料口7向下掉落至收纳腔28内,进行收料。During specific use, black tea leaves are put into the fermentation tank 3 through the inlet and outlet 7, the gear 10 is driven to rotate by the dual-axis motor 9, and then the gear ring 11 is driven to rotate, so that the fermentation tank 3 rotates, and the driving motor 13 is started, and the stirring shaft 15 is driven to rotate by the bevel gear 14, and then the scraper 17 and the stirring rod 18 are driven to rotate, and the tea leaves are turned over. The water pump 21 sprays the tea leaves through the spray pipe 23 and the spray head 25, and the internal tea leaves are evenly heated by the set heating block, hot air blower 22, hot air pipe 24 and hot air outlet 26. After fermentation is completed, the inlet and outlet 7 is dropped downward into the storage chamber 28 for collection.
